Mitigating Windows Update Risks: Strategies for Admins
Practical, repeatable strategies for IT admins to reduce Windows Update incidents, speed remediation, and control costs.
Mitigating Windows Update Risks: Strategies for Admins
Windows Updates are vital to security and stability — but they can also introduce downtime, regressions, and unexpected cost. This definitive guide gives IT admins pragmatic, repeatable strategies to reduce post-update incidents, accelerate remediation, and keep systems secure and cost-efficient.
Introduction: Why Windows Update Risk Management Matters
Windows Update failures cause more than lost hours. They ripple into compliance gaps, delayed releases, and unpredictable cloud spend when workloads are reprovisioned to recover availability. Modern organizations need a disciplined approach that blends governance, testing, telemetry, and communication. For teams designing consistent device policies, look at patterns from cross-platform device management: Making Technology Work Together: Cross-Device Management with Google for ideas on policy cohesion across endpoints.
Admins also borrow operational thinking from related domains: operational excellence and IoT installation practices show how rigorous validation reduces field failures — see Operational Excellence: How to Utilize IoT in Fire Alarm Installation for process and automation parallels. And for practical device-level protections, review DIY approaches to data safety: DIY Data Protection: Safeguarding Your Devices Against Unexpected Vulnerabilities.
This guide is for platform engineers, desktop admins, and IT leaders responsible for hundreds to tens of thousands of Windows endpoints. It focuses on actionable patterns: ringed rollouts, pre-release testing, rollback planning, telemetry-driven troubleshooting, and cost-aware recovery.
1. Map the Update Risk Surface
Inventory and Categorize
Start with a definitive inventory of devices, OS versions, and roles: domain controllers, jump hosts, VDI hosts, developer workstations, and production servers. Map business criticality and dependency chains. You can adopt spreadsheet-driven analysis to visualize impacts — similar techniques are used when forecasting commodity price risks: Harnessing Agricultural Trends: A Spreadsheet for Crop Price Analysis.
Attack Surface and Vulnerability Prioritization
Not all updates are equal. Security updates for remote code execution should be applied more aggressively than feature updates for nonessential endpoints. Prioritize updates that mitigate exploited CVEs and map them to exposure profiles. Cross-reference change windows with other platform events to avoid compounding risk.
Telemetry Baselines
Establish pre-update baselines for performance, boot time, and application health. Use the same metrics discipline used for product engagement: measuring app behavior is similar to tracking reader engagement for digital products — see approaches in The Rise of UK News Apps: Insights into Reader Engagement and Trends.
2. Governance and Policy: Define Clear Update Rules
Classify Devices and Define Rings
Use ring deployments: Canary (1–5 machines), Pilot (team-level), Broad (business units), and Production (all remaining). Document which device types belong to each ring and who owns approvals. This mirrors intake pipeline rules — how you accept changes into a controlled flow: Building Effective Client Intake Pipelines: Lessons from Financial Technology. Treat updates like releases and gate them similarly.
Policy Enforcement with MDM and Group Policy
Enforce update deferral and installation windows via MDM (Intune) and group policies. Ensure update settings are auditable and tied to SLAs. For endpoint features and home-office parity, review design patterns for connected homes and smart features: Creating a Tech-Savvy Retreat: Enhancing Homes with Smart Features, and apply the discipline to corporate fleets.
Approval Workflows and Emergency Exceptions
Define an emergency patch approval flow for high-severity CVEs. Keep a documented exception table and rollback plan. Communicate how and when to break glass, and automate alerts to the on-call rota during critical rollouts.
3. Update Strategies: Choose the Right Approach
Phased Ring Deployment
Phased rings reduce blast radius. Roll builds to Canary, measure, then expand. This minimizes the probability of hitting critical systems at once and buys time to catch regressions.
Feature vs Security Separations
Separate security-only updates from feature updates. Security updates often need faster application; feature updates can follow a slower cadence after validation. Use shelving policies for feature updates on production servers unless a patch fixes a security issue.
Canary Builds and A/B Patterns
Implement canary test groups with mixed workloads to surface integration issues. Pair a canary with one or two monitoring suites covering application, network, and storage metrics so you can compare pre/post states.
Comparison Table: Update Strategies
| Strategy | Use Case | Risk | Recovery Time | Cost |
|---|---|---|---|---|
| Immediate Patch-All | High-severity CVE | High (blast radius) | Fast if no regressions | Low direct, high risk cost |
| Phased Rings | General updates | Low (controlled) | Moderate | Moderate (operational) |
| Canary First | Feature updates | Very Low | Slower (measurement) | Low |
| Manual Pilot | Critical apps | Medium | Variable | Higher (manual testing) |
| Deferred/Long-Term Servicing | Air-gapped/regulated systems | Low (stable) | Long (planned) | Potentially high due to backporting |
4. Pre-Update Testing and Validation
Automated Test Suites
Automate smoke tests for the critical user journeys of each endpoint class. Include login, application launch, file access, and scheduled tasks. Leverage CI tooling that runs on VM images mirroring target configurations; this is similar to how performance metrics are instrumented for advertising applications — see Performance Metrics for AI Video Ads: Going Beyond Basic Analytics for telemetry best practices.
Hardware and Driver Compatibility
Feature updates often depend on driver compatibility. Maintain a matrix of approved drivers and OS versions. Use a canary fleet with representative hardware profiles — the hardware enthusiasm and variation lessons seen in GPU adoption can inform your driver compatibility testing: Gaming and GPU Enthusiasm: Navigating the Current Landscape.
Capacity and Performance Testing
Measure system load and boot time. Track changes across releases in a reproducible dataset — spreadsheets and repeatable analyses are useful, as shown in commodity trend work: Harnessing Agricultural Trends: A Spreadsheet for Crop Price Analysis. Capture before/after snapshots to spot regressions early.
5. Rollback and Recovery Planning
Define Recovery Objectives
Set clear RTO and RPO values for each device class. Rollback speed is useless if backups are slow or inconsistent. Make sure system restore points, image-based backups, and configuration-as-code are in place for fast recovery.
Test Rollbacks Regularly
Practice rollback drills. Recreate a failed update scenario and run your playbook. Document time to restore and iterate. This mimics emergency exercise regimes used in physical system installations: lessons from IoT operations show the value of rehearsals — see Operational Excellence: How to Utilize IoT in Fire Alarm Installation.
Immutable Images and Golden Masters
Maintain golden images for critical roles so you can redeploy quickly. Combine with configuration management to re-attach policies and applications after image replacement.
6. Staged Deployment Patterns & Automation
Automate Ring Progression
Use automation to move updates between rings based on defined success criteria (health checks, error rates, user complaints). This reduces human delay and prevents premature broad rollouts. The principles are similar to supply chain automation that uses defined thresholds to move inventory: Leveraging AI in Your Supply Chain for Greater Transparency and Efficiency.
Policy-as-Code
Encode ring definitions, approvals, and exceptions in a single declarative repo to avoid drift. Treat policy as code and pipeline it through CI. Teams stacking multiple tools benefit from centralizing rules, like brand teams centralize messaging on platforms: Harnessing Substack for Your Brand: SEO Tactics to Amplify Brand Reach — the lesson is consistent, reproducible communication.
Edge and Hybrid Scenarios
For remote or edge devices, plan for intermittent connectivity. Use a staged delivery that retries with back-offs and provides a local rollback mechanism. For travel-heavy teams, ensure the same network hygiene you expect in hotels and conference locations — consider static controls like travel routers when troubleshooting remote connectivity: High-Tech Travel: Why You Should Use a Travel Router for Your Hotel Stays.
7. Monitoring, Telemetry, and Troubleshooting
What to Monitor
Key signals include update failure counts, boot times, CPU & memory anomalies, driver errors, and application crashes. Include user-experience measures: login success rates and primary application latencies.
Alerting and Escalation
Define thresholds and automated escalation paths. Triage dashboards should identify the impacted ring and device class. Use historical patterns to detect noise vs signal — similar to how marketers separate vanity metrics from meaningful engagement: see analytics approaches in The Rise of UK News Apps: Insights into Reader Engagement and Trends.
Distributed Tracing & Logs
Collect logs centrally and correlate them with update events. When investigating regressions, correlate Windows Update logs, application logs, and telemetry. Performance-driven investigations borrow techniques used in ad-performance analysis: Performance Metrics for AI Video Ads: Going Beyond Basic Analytics.
Pro Tip: Always capture a pre-update snapshot (system image and logs). That snapshot reduces MTTR by 30–70% in practice because it gives you a clean baseline to compare against.
8. Security and Compliance Considerations
Maintain Proof of Patch State
For audits, keep an immutable record of which KBs were applied to which devices and when. Use central reporting and automated attestations. Knowledge management patterns from large projects show the importance of curated datasets: consider how large knowledge platforms manage partnerships and provenance: Wikimedia's Sustainable Future: The Role of AI Partnerships in Knowledge Curation.
Least-Privilege and Update Agents
Ensure update agents run under minimally privileged accounts and that service-account keys rotate. Segment update infrastructure on separate management subnets and limit access via jump hosts. The principle of least-privilege applies to deployment automation just as it does to other critical systems.
Data Protection During Updates
Avoid update processes that can expose sensitive volumes. Encrypt sensitive partitions and validate that update tools do not write secrets to logs. For device-level protections and incident prevention, review DIY data protection strategies: DIY Data Protection: Safeguarding Your Devices Against Unexpected Vulnerabilities.
9. Cost Optimization and Resource Management
Avoid Over-Provisioning During Recovery
When updates fail at scale, teams sometimes spin up additional VMs or duplicate resources as a bandage, which increases cloud spend. Plan for controlled failover strategies and prefer immutable deploys over cloning production capacity. Energy and resource efficiency discipline from home and appliance design is instructive: Maximizing Your Kitchen’s Energy Efficiency with Smart Appliances demonstrates how small changes compound into significant savings.
Track Cost Impact of Outages
Calculate the per-minute cost of downtime to inform acceptable rollout speeds and automation budgets. Recording this metric improves prioritization of investment into testing automation and can justify higher tooling expense for faster recovery.
Hardware Replacement vs Fix
Decide when to replace hardware vs fixing drivers or configuration drift. Gaming and GPU market lessons show that hardware scarcity or driver changes can force different operational choices — read about that landscape in Gaming and GPU Enthusiasm: Navigating the Current Landscape.
10. Communication, Training, and Change Management
Release Notes and Audience-Specific Messaging
Publish concise release notes and expected impact. Use channels appropriate to the audience — engineering teams need logs and rollback instructions; business users need simple instructions and expected downtimes. The communication cadence parallels brand messaging strategies — tips in Harnessing Substack for Your Brand: SEO Tactics to Amplify Brand Reach apply to release notes: clarity, consistency, and measurable feedback loops.
Enablement and Runbooks
Provide runbooks with step-by-step troubleshooting for top 10 update failures. Include command lines, log locations, and escalation points. Practice runbooks in war-room drills to ensure they are accurate under pressure.
Training and Cross-Team Coordination
Train helpdesk staff to handle common post-update calls and tag incidents for trending. Coordinate with network, storage, and application teams before updates so interdependencies are accounted for — this collaborative approach mirrors cross-functional event planning in other industries: Seasonal Gardening Strategies for Urban Dwellers demonstrates planning cycles and coordinated actions over a season — apply the same planning horizon to updates.
11. Real-World Patterns and Case Examples
Case: Canary Saves a Fleet
A mid-sized company deployed a preview feature to a 20-machine canary. Telemetry flagged a driver crash impacting disk I/O within 90 minutes. Canary prevented broader impact and enabled a targeted driver rollback in under 3 hours. This outcome reflects automated ring progression best practices described earlier.
Case: Rapid Rollback with Golden Images
Another team used golden images for jump hosts and restored service by redeploying images, reattaching volumes, and running configuration scripts in under 45 minutes. The practice of rehearsed rollback echoes operational reliability strategies used in complex installations such as IoT alarm deployments: Operational Excellence: How to Utilize IoT in Fire Alarm Installation.
Lessons from Other Domains
Lessons from non-IT fields can be surprisingly applicable. For example, measuring customer attention in digital publications or ad systems teaches us to refine telemetry and separate noise from meaningful signals — see analytics frameworks in Performance Metrics for AI Video Ads: Going Beyond Basic Analytics and engagement studies in The Rise of UK News Apps: Insights into Reader Engagement and Trends.
12. Operational Checklist: From Planning to Post-Mortem
Pre-Update
Inventory devices; define rings; generate baseline telemetry; produce a rollback snapshot; schedule low-risk deployment windows.
During Update
Monitor health dashboards; keep close communication; enforce automated gates; be ready to halt or roll back.
Post-Update and Post-Mortem
Run regression checks, collect incident data, calculate outage cost, and feed lessons back into policy-as-code. For longer-term knowledge curation and partnerships, take inspiration from how large knowledge orgs manage living documentation: Wikimedia's Sustainable Future: The Role of AI Partnerships in Knowledge Curation.
Conclusion: Treat Updates as High-Risk Releases
Windows Updates are not routine chores — they are high-risk changes that require engineering rigor. Use ringed rollouts, automated testing, measured telemetry, and practiced rollback steps. Cross-functional coordination, clear communication, and cost-awareness reduce both risk and surprise.
Implementing the strategies in this guide will reduce incident rates, shorten recovery windows, and ensure updates deliver security without destabilizing your environment. For additional operational patterns and automation inspirations, browse methods from adjacent domains like supply-chain automation: Leveraging AI in Your Supply Chain for Greater Transparency and Efficiency, and endpoint management tactics in Making Technology Work Together: Cross-Device Management with Google.
FAQ
1) How quickly should I apply security updates?
Prioritize high-severity CVEs for rapid deployment to critical endpoints (within 24–72 hours depending on exposure). Use phased rings for broad application and keep emergency exceptions narrow. For non-critical feature updates, test thoroughly before wide release.
2) What’s the best rollback method after a failed update?
Use image-based rollbacks for servers and system restore or snapshot rollbacks for workstations. Pre-built golden images plus configuration scripts typically yield the fastest MTTR.
3) How do I limit cloud cost during an outage?
Avoid immediate horizontal scaling to mask issues. Use controlled failover to reserved capacity and prioritize restoring existing instances. Track downtime cost to decide between manual fixes vs reprovisioning.
4) How can I reduce driver-related regressions?
Maintain an approved driver matrix, test drivers in a hardware-representative canary pool, and use signed driver enforcement. Monitor driver-specific telemetry post-update.
5) Which metrics matter most post-update?
Boot time, update failure rate, application crash rate, latency of critical application flows, and user-facing login success rates. Correlate with logs for root cause analysis.
Related Topics
Unknown
Contributor
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.
Up Next
More stories handpicked for you
Gaming in the Cloud: The Future of Performance with Steam Machine
Adaptive Workplaces: What Meta's Exit from VR Signals for Collaboration Tools
Navigating the Drone Tech Battlefield: Waze vs Google Maps in Emergency Response
Unleashing the Power of Bug Bounty Programs: Lessons from Hytale
Performance Fixes in Gaming: Examining the Monster Hunter Wilds Dilemma
From Our Network
Trending stories across our publication group